Static electricity is the phenomenon of charge transfer between two objects, which may cause harm to equipment and personnel in the working environment. An anti-static workbench is a work environment specifically designed to reduce static electricity. Below are some methods to avoid the hazards of static electricity.
Firstly, keep the workbench and surrounding environment clean. The surface of the anti-static workbench should be kept dry, clean, and regularly cleaned. Ensure that there is no accumulation of dust or debris, which can reduce the generation of static electricity.
Secondly, use an electrostatic precipitator. Electrostatic precipitators can effectively remove static electricity from surfaces and surrounding environments, reducing the possibility of static electricity accumulation.
Additionally, use anti-static equipment and materials. When working on an anti-static workbench, specially designed anti-static equipment such as static elimination zones and anti-static gloves should be used. Meanwhile, the use of anti-static materials can effectively reduce the accumulation and transmission of static electricity.
In addition, regularly inspect anti-static equipment. Ensure the normal operation of anti-static workstations and equipment, regularly inspect and maintain equipment, and promptly address any potential issues.
Train employees. Provide static electricity protection training to employees, enabling them to understand the hazards and prevention methods of static electricity, and enhance their awareness of static electricity protection.
In summary, by maintaining a clean environment, using electrostatic precipitators, anti-static equipment and materials, regularly inspecting equipment, and training employees, the static electricity hazards on the anti-static workbench can be effectively reduced, ensuring work safety and normal equipment operation.
